A Historical Context: The Evolution of Teer in Meghalaya
To understand the significance of Shillong and Jowai Teer, it is essential to delve into the history of archery in Meghalaya. The state's indigenous communities have a long-standing tradition of archery, which was initially used for hunting and warfare. Over time, this skill was adapted into a sport, with the Khasi Hills Archery Sports Association playing a pivotal role in organizing and promoting the game. The association's efforts led to the development of the Teer game, which has become an integral part of Meghalaya's cultural landscape.
The Teer game has undergone significant transformations since its inception. Initially, the game was played with a simple target, and the results were determined by the number of arrows that hit the target. However, with the passage of time, the game has become more sophisticated, with the introduction of a standardized target and a well-defined set of rules. The game's popularity has also led to the establishment of a formal betting system, which has contributed to its economic significance.
Mechanics and Popularity: Understanding the Teer Phenomenon
The Teer game operates on a simple yet engaging premise. In each session, archers shoot arrows at a target, and participants bet on the last two digits of the total arrows hitting the target. The game's mechanics are designed to ensure fairness and transparency, with the results being declared twice daily in Shillong and Jowai. The prize structure is lucrative, with participants standing to win significant amounts of money for correct predictions.
The game's popularity can be attributed to its simplicity and the potential for high returns. With two rounds held daily, participants have multiple opportunities to win, making the game an attractive option for those looking to make a quick profit. The game's organizers have also implemented a system to ensure that the game is played fairly, with measures in place to prevent cheating and ensure that the results are accurate.
